December Update

As 2014 begins to wind down, LRC continued to look for avenues in which to compete.  The first opportunity for that was at the California International Marathon in Sacramento, CA. Four LRC individuals made it to the start line, but despite good starts by all, only Ryan Regnier (2:41:28) and Brian Wandzilak (2:44:49) finished the race.  Those two times place them 6th and 7th on the all-time charts, respectively.  In addition, LRC Alum Eric Noel ran an outstanding time of 2:22:39, which eclipsed his previous best by over two minutes! Eric now works as a professor at Cal Poly University in San Luis Obispo, CA.  Sadly, Eric’s time is not eligible for an LRC record given his alumni status.

On that same day, LRC represented at the Lincoln Track Club’s Holiday Run 5k at Pioneers Park.  LRC placed 1-4 in the men’s race, as Ivan Ivanov, Ryan Salem, Derek Sekora and Brian Kelley led the way.  As there’s no official results for the Capital Humane Society fundraiser, times were not immediately available.

Finally, LRC Racing took a step in a new direction as they sent a men’s team to the USATF Club Cross Country championships in Bethlehem, PA.  The race took place this past Sunday (December 14th), and 572 men competed in the open race (almost twice as big as your normal NCAA championship races).  Cole Marolf led the way through the 10k course (222nd, 32:34), followed by Trevor Vidlak (238th, 32:45), Neil Wolford (311th, 33:35), Andrew Jacob (368th, 34:09) and Michael Rathje (391st, 34:34).  Ryan Dostal also represented the team on the big stage (449th, 35:35).  Despite the very muddy conditions, LRC placed 45th out of 72 teams and made up 75% of the Nebraska representation.

With these races completed and the new year fast approaching, there are very few opportunities for LRC to race before this winter’s indoor track season.  With that being said, keep an eye out for the blue and yellow to be involved in as many track meets as allowed by race directors.
